To master the art of team collaboration and showcase it on your resume, it's crucial to identify the key skills that contribute to successful teamwork. First and foremost, effective communication lays the foundation for collaboration. Being able to clearly convey ideas, actively listen to others, and provide constructive feedback are essential communication skills that promote understanding and strengthen collaboration. Active listening is another vital skill in team collaboration. It involves paying attention to others' perspectives, understanding their needs, and empathizing with their viewpoints. By actively listening, you can create a supportive and inclusive environment where everyone's ideas are valued. Conflict resolution is an indispensable skill for collaborative success. In any team, conflicts are bound to arise. Being able to navigate these conflicts with tact, respect, and a focus on finding common ground is crucial for maintaining positive team dynamics and fostering collaboration. Adaptability is also key in team collaboration. The ability to be flexible, open-minded, and willing to embrace new ideas and approaches allows for seamless teamwork, especially in dynamic work environments. Lastly, leadership skills play a significant role in team collaboration. A good team collaborator knows how to guide, motivate, and inspire team members toward a shared goal. Leadership in collaboration involves facilitating discussions, delegating tasks, and ensuring everyone's contributions are valued. By recognizing and developing these essential team collaboration skills, you'll be better equipped to demonstrate your ability to work effectively in a team environment on your resume. Showcasing Team Collaboration on Your Resume When it comes to highlighting your team collaboration skills on your resume, strategic presentation is key. Begin by selecting a resume format that allows you to emphasize collaboration experiences. In the work history section, incorporate specific examples of your involvement in successful team projects. Describe your role, responsibilities, and contributions, showcasing how your collaboration skills played a vital part in achieving team goals. To make your resume stand out, quantify the results and outcomes you achieved through collaboration, such as increased productivity or successful project completion. Use strong action verbs to convey your ability to work effectively in teams. Demonstrating Team Collaboration in Job Interviews Job interviews provide a crucial opportunity to showcase your team collaboration skills and convince potential employers of your ability to thrive in a collaborative work environment. Here are some strategies to effectively demonstrate your teamwork prowess: Prepare relevant examples Before the interview, identify specific instances where you successfully collaborated with others. Highlight projects where you worked closely with a team, detailing your role, the challenges faced, and the positive outcomes achieved through collective effort. Share success stories During the interview, articulate your experiences of effective teamwork by sharing success stories. Explain how you contributed to the team's goals, the strategies employed, and how your collaboration skills played a significant role in achieving success. Discuss challenges and solutions Address any obstacles or conflicts that arose during collaborative projects. Explain how you navigated these challenges, resolved conflicts, and fostered a harmonious working environment, emphasizing your ability to handle adversity and find effective solutions. Adaptability and flexibility Highlight your adaptability to different team dynamics and work styles. Demonstrate your willingness to accommodate diverse perspectives and ideas, showcasing your ability to collaborate effectively with individuals from various backgrounds and roles. By leveraging these strategies, you can impress interviewers with your team collaboration skills, proving that you are a valuable asset who can contribute to the success of their organization.
